But what, exactly, are the benefits of using natural esters?

We have worked with natural ester liquids in our laboratory for years. There are some differences when we consider the testing, analysis, and field service, but the core purpose of natural esters—which include FR3—is the same as mineral oil. Both natural esters and mineral oil share the following:

  • Provide dielectric strength
  • Provide heat transfer
  • Protect the solid insulation (the paper)
  • Allow laboratory testing to take place, which can give an indication of the condition inside the equipment, and therefore act as a diagnostic tool.

FR3 is derived from seed oils with the addition of performance-enhancing additives. It is a renewable, biobased natural ester dielectric coolant and insulating liquid designed specifically for transformers, where its unique fire safety, environmental, electrical, and chemical properties are advantageous.

There are several advantages to FR3. It is biodegradable. FR3 fluid does not contain any petroleum, halogens, silicones, or corrosive sulfur. Environmentally, it quickly biodegrades in the environment. It is non-toxic to aquatic life and is non-toxic in oral toxicity tests.

FR3 is classified as a “less flammable” fluid with a Fire Point of ≥300°C versus ~160°C for mineral oil. This is the highest ignition resistance of any high fire point dielectric fluid available. This means that even if an undetectable and catastrophic failure occurs, a fire is unlikely to start.

It has been seen that FR3 can hold more moisture without causing harm to the beneficial properties of the insulation, also helping to reduce the moisture in the paper insulation of the transformer, especially in a retrofill situation, and that FR3 will chemically strengthen the paper insulation, giving the paper the ability to operate at higher temperatures and/or have longer life.

SDMyers can fill new transformers with FR3 or perform retrofills on existing transformers – replacing their original fluid (such as mineral oil) with FR3. We can perform fluid dehydration and degassing, processing the FR3 through heat and vacuum to lower the FR3’s moisture and dissolved gas content.
